Prerequisites

The guidelines below are compulsory:

  • the following link will direct you to the place where USB drivers are;
  • these work very well with your handset, so they must be downloaded on your laptop;
  • install the drivers there;
  • enable USB Debugging on your Sony Xperia M;
  • perform a backup that will protect the content of your handset;
  • generate, afterwards, a full NANDroid backup;
  • the laptop’s OS must be the Windows version;
  • your smartphone must be featuring a charged battery;
  • all of your phone’s and laptop’s security programs must be turned off during the rooting.

Step by step instructions

The above, called requirements, must be completed before the rooting. If they’re been taken care of, steps will follow.

  1. Such as this one: open, using your laptop, this particular site. Following its launch, see if you spot a download button. After seeing it, make sure you click on it with your mouse.
  2. Applying this first step lets the SRSRoot appear on your laptop after the download. Be sure to flash and open the freeware on the same device next.
  3. This is the next step: tap Menu, activate Settings and enable Unknown Sources. The last of these options is under the second one on our list.
  4. From here, have the following tapped, too: USB Debugging. The option may already be activated; if so, let this step behind you.
  5. Move to the following action: with the phone’s USB cord, create a connection between the device and your laptop. This won’t be a lengthy process; in a couple of minutes you’ll be able to start another task.
  6. This time, you need to initiate the rooting of your phone. There’s nothing easier to do here than to tap Root Device (All Methods) on this gadget.
  7. Immediately after doing as much, the Sony C1904 will begin the process. This is something which isn’t going to be over in a few minutes.
  8. An approximate duration between 10 and 15 minutes. The answer to a procedure that takes too long: make sure the previous steps are repeated once again.
